Article title

Fault detection in dynamic processes using a simplified monitoring-specific CVA state space modelling approach

Additional information

This paper presents a novel formulation of state-space canonical variate analysis (CVA) models (using three parameter matrices instead of five) in models which were developed for the specific purpose of process condition monitoring. The method is shown to be computationally very efficient yet gives comparable or better fault detection performance than the conventional CVA based process monitoring approaches.
